What A Two-Ton Gas Furnace Means

A two-ton furnace provides roughly 60,000 BTU/h of heating capacity, a typical size for many mid-sized homes. Proper sizing hinges on a professional load calculation (often a Manual J). Oversized units can short-cycle, wasting energy and reducing comfort, while undersized units struggle to maintain stable temperatures, especially during peak winter days. Homeowners should plan for performance and efficiency considerations alongside capacity when evaluating price.

Price Overview: Unit Price And Installed Cost

Prices vary by efficiency, brand, and features. The following ranges reflect common market conditions in the United States for a two-ton gas furnace (before adapting for local labor rates and ductwork needs):

Item Typical Price Range Notes
Furnace Unit Price (80% AFUE) $1,600 – $3,000 Standard efficiency, basic features
Furnace Unit Price (90–95% AFUE) $2,200 – $4,000 Higher efficiency, better energy performance
Installed Price (Typical, including labor) $4,000 – $8,000 Includes labor, venting, basic ductwork; varies by region

Note that installed costs can exceed the upper range if ductwork needs extensive modification, new gas piping is required, or venting is complex. Conversely, existing, well-maintained duct systems with straightforward vent runs may stay near the lower end of the range.

Key Factors That Drive Price

  • AFUE And Efficiency Level: Higher efficiency (90–95% AFUE or higher) typically costs more upfront but lowers annual heating bills, often paying back the difference over time.
  • Furnace Type And Features: Two-stage or modulating furnaces, ECM blowers, and variable-speed technology add cost but improve comfort and efficiency.
  • Brand And Warranty: Premium brands tend to be pricier but may offer longer warranties and better service networks.
  • Installation Complexity: Duct modifications, gas line sizing, venting, and condensate drainage can significantly affect labor hours and total price.
  • Existing Infrastructure: An older home with outdated ducts, limited clearance, or poor gas supply can raise costs for proper integration.

Common Additional Costs And Considerations

  • Permits And Inspections: Local requirements may add fees and add time to the project.
  • Ductwork Modifications: Leaks, dirty ducts, or undersized ducts can necessitate repairs or redesigns for optimal airflow.
  • Smart thermostats or zoning systems add price but improve efficiency and comfort.
  • Proper gas line sizing and venting are critical for safety and performance.
  • Removal and disposal typically incur a disposal fee or haul-away service.

Comparing With Alternatives And Long-Term Savings

In some climates, a gas furnace paired with a natural-gas or propane backup water heater may remain a strong choice, but homeowners should weigh alternatives. Heat pumps, especially cold-climate models, are increasingly viable and can reduce heating costs in milder seasons. A dual-fuel setup combines a heat pump with a gas furnace to optimize efficiency across temperature ranges. While initial costs for heat pumps or dual-fuel systems can be higher, potential energy savings and rebates may shorten payback periods over time.

How To Get An Accurate Quote

  • Start With A Load Calculation: Request a comprehensive Manual J calculation from each installer to determine the correct size for your home.
  • Ask For Itemized Bids: Ensure quotes list unit price, installation labor, ductwork work, venting, permits, and disposal separately.
  • Compare AFUE And Features: Look beyond price to efficiency ratings, blower type, warranty length, and included diagnostics or maintenance plans.
  • Check References And Warranties: Favor installers offering solid warranties on both parts and labor, plus service after installation.
  • Confirm Timeline And Permits: Verify what permits are needed and the projected timeline, including potential delays due to scheduling or weather.
  • Evaluate Financing Options: Inquire about payment plans, rebates, and utility incentives that can reduce upfront costs.

Warranty And Aftercare

Most gas furnaces come with a manufacturer’s warranty on the heat exchanger and parts, plus a separate labor warranty from the installer. Typical coverage ranges from five to ten years for parts, with labor warranties varying by contractor. Extended warranties are available, but buyers should weigh the cost against the likelihood of needing service in the warranty period. Regular maintenance, annual tune-ups, and filter replacements help preserve efficiency and can prevent unexpected breakdowns that drive additional costs.

Frequently Asked Questions

  • Is a two-ton furnace enough for a larger home? Sizing must be confirmed by a professional. An undersized unit will struggle to heat, while an oversized unit can waste energy. A qualified HVAC contractor should perform a precise load calculation for accurate results.
  • When should I replace rather than repair? If the furnace is beyond its expected lifespan (typically 15–20 years for gas furnaces) or repair costs exceed a reasonable portion of the replacement price, replacement is often the smarter long-term option.
  • Do high-efficiency furnaces justify the cost? Higher AFUE units cost more initially but can yield meaningful energy savings over time, especially in regions with long, cold winters.
